There are mixed views from Dublin citizens on how the city is marking being one thousand years old.

As Dublin celebrates being a thousand years old there are divided opinions on what the millennium is and how it should be celebrated. 

In the mid-1980s much of Dublin city was in a dilapidated state and the city manager at the time Frank Feely came up with the idea to celebrate the city's millennium. It was hoped that the celebrations marking a thousand years of Dublin would provide a much-needed boost for the city and its citizens.

'Evening Extra' took to the streets of Dublin to find out what the citizens thought about the millennium and reactions were varied.

This episode of 'Evening Extra' was broadcast on 11 February 1988. The presenter is Bibi Baskin.
